|
Guarantees and Contigent Liabilities - Contract or Notional Amounts of Unfunded Commitments to Extend Credit (Detail) (USD $)
In Millions, unless otherwise specified
|
Dec. 31, 2014
|Commercial and Commercial Real Estate [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|$ 113,269us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CommercialAndCommercialRealEstateMember
|Corporate and Purchasing Cards [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|21,301us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CorporateAndPurchasingCardsMember
|Residential Mortgages [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|84us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ResidentialPortfolioSegmentMember
|Retail Credit Cards [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|78,768us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_RetailCreditCardsMember
|Other Retail [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|31,493us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ConsumerOtherFinancingReceivableMember
|Covered Loans [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|667us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CoveredFinancingReceivableMember
|Federal Funds [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|5,258us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_FederalFundsMember
|Less Than One Year [Member] | Commercial and Commercial Real Estate [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|24,161us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CommercialAndCommercialRealEstateM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Less Than One Year [Member] | Corporate and Purchasing Cards [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|21,301us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CorporateAndPurchasingCardsM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Less Than One Year [Member] | Residential Mortgages [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|70us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ResidentialPortfolioSegmentM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Less Than One Year [Member] | Retail Credit Cards [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|78,578us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_RetailCreditCardsM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Less Than One Year [Member] | Other Retail [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|12,217us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ConsumerOtherFinancingReceivableM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Less Than One Year [Member] | Federal Funds [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|5,258us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_FederalFundsMember
/ us-gaap_RangeAxis
= usb_LessThanOneYearMember
|Greater Than One Year [Member] | Commercial and Commercial Real Estate [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|89,108us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CommercialAndCommercialRealEstateMember
/ us-gaap_RangeAxis
= usb_GreaterThanOneYearMember
|Greater Than One Year [Member] | Residential Mortgages [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|14us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ResidentialPortfolioSegmentMember
/ us-gaap_RangeAxis
= usb_GreaterThanOneYearMember
|Greater Than One Year [Member] | Retail Credit Cards [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|190us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_RetailCreditCardsMember
/ us-gaap_RangeAxis
= usb_GreaterThanOneYearMember
|Greater Than One Year [Member] | Other Retail [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|19,276us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= us-gaap_ConsumerOtherFinancingReceivableMember
/ us-gaap_RangeAxis
= usb_GreaterThanOneYearMember
|Greater Than One Year [Member] | Covered Loans [Member]
|
|Unfunded Commitments to Extend Credit [Line Items]
|
|Contract or notional amounts of unfunded commitments to extend credit
|$ 667us-gaap_UnusedCommitmentsToExtendCredit
/ us-gaap_OtherCommitmentsAxis
= usb_CoveredFinancingReceivableMember
/ us-gaap_RangeAxis
= usb_GreaterThanOneYearMember